Outdoor furniture, especially wooden tables, is prone to warping when exposed to extreme weather conditions like a simoom—a hot, dry desert wind. To keep your outdoor table in top shape, follow these practical steps:
1. Choose the Right Material: Opt for weather-resistant woods like teak, cedar, or treated lumber, which are less likely to warp under harsh conditions.
2. Apply a Protective Finish: Regularly seal your table with a high-quality weatherproof sealant or oil to shield it from moisture and heat.
3. Use a Cover: When not in use, cover your table with a breathable, waterproof cover to protect it from direct sunlight and wind.
4. Proper Placement: Position your table in a shaded area or under a pergola to minimize exposure to intense heat and wind.
5. Regular Maintenance: Inspect your table periodically for cracks or signs of wear, and reapply protective coatings as needed.
By taking these precautions, you can significantly reduce the risk of warping and extend the lifespan of your outdoor table, even in a simoom.
